The Effect – National Theatre
Electroacoustic composition, created from sounds of the laboratory, for the 2012 play by Lucy Prebble about a love affair that develops on a clinical trial. At The National Theatre (Cottesloe), directed by Rupert Goold – a co-production with Headlong.
